• Nom — Mitsuhiro Mihara • Born — 1964 • Birthplace — Kyoto (Japon) • Nationality — Japonaise • Occupation — Réalisateur Scénariste, né en 1964 à Kyoto, est un réalisateur japonais.
Biographie
Mihara Mitsuhiro fait ses études à l'université des arts d'Osaka.
Cinéma
• 1998: Hiroin! Naniwa bombers • 2000: Eri ni kubittake • 2001: Ashita wa kitto • 2002: Dojji go go! • 2004: • 2006: Sukitomo • 2007: Yaneura no sanposha • 2008: • 2010: Murasaki kagami • 2011: Merii-san no denwa • 2014: Otome no reshipi • 2015: Ashita ni nareba • 2017: Mohican ke no kazoku kaigi
Télévision
• 2012: Mukōda Kuniko Innocent (série TV)
